Coinbase Stock Slips As Court Sides With US SEC In Document Seal

Coinbase stock has plunged by 3% as its lawsuit with the United States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) took a new twist recently. Judge Katherine Polk Failla sided with the regulator in a new ruling. While the win does not mean an end to the lawsuit, it has triggered a bearish switch with the firm’s investors as showcased in its stock price.

Coinbase Stock Plunges Following New Ruling

As reported earlier, the exchange has requested relief from the court with respect to the release of some key documents relating to the case. As CLO Paul Grewal explained following an earlier filing, that the US SEC is not playing by the same rules shows there is no fairness.

However, Judge Failla saw things differently and denied Coinbase’ request. As of writing, Coinbase stock has dropped by 3.67% to $153.66.
